    When we went shopping the 11 did nothing for us at all; the 13A was a huge jump in every way; at that time the 13A were 15k US and the 15A 25k US; the 13A seemed the sweet spot also the 15A required a larger room than we had and by all accounts because of the wider panel were more diffuse in presentation. 4 10” powered woofers that blend after ARC seamlessly with the panel! Previous generation Montis did not do that at all.

    Hey, hey, hey! That photo with the trio from the Masterpiece series is missing one. The CLASSIC NINE! It is the only of the series that shares the PASSIVE scheme of the Neolith. It is also the ONLY electrostatic in the ENTIRE line that has it's own sized panel shared with no other model. (just some trivia for you fellows). I got this directly from Andy and Andrew .
